Subject: Quickstore 4.2 — bloom filter now fronts the KV layer

Plugin authors: starting with this release, Quickstore places a bloom filter ahead of the key-value store. Negative lookups return faster; false positives fall through safely. No API changes are required on your side. Verify your plugin against the staging build referenced below.

session token of fahif-tadup = htk3_9c7

## Service Accounts — StormFan Alert Fan-Out

The fan-out worker authenticates to the internal dispatch tier using the svc-stormfan account. Rotate quarterly; scopes are limited to publish-only on alert topics. If deliveries stall during your shift, verify the worker is using the current credential, reproduced below for reference.

API key for kaweg-hahif: kto4_rAjZ

**Ticket PX-2291: Signature check failed after catalog cache flush**

After yesterday's invalidation sweep on the Marroweave product catalog, plugin bundles served from the warm tier fail verification. Stale digests were cached alongside fresh artifacts, so checks compare mismatched versions. Plugin authors should rebuild against the current snapshot and verify with the key below.

deploy key for hawef-bafog: bky13_1N9K4SjjejvXh

// Fixture for tailcli integration tests.
// tailcli streams logs from the Fernwood aggregator; this fixture
// replays a canned stream so tests never touch production.
// Security note: scopes here are read-only and limited to the
// sandbox tenant. The harness authenticates the replay endpoint
// with the bearer token that follows.

session JWT of yawep-yawep = eyJhbGciOiJIUzI1NiIsInR5cCI6IkpXVCJ9.eyJzdWIiOiI3pWF3_In0.aXYsHiog

**Mgmt Meeting Minutes — Retiring the Brightline Range**

Quick recap for sales leads at Fenholt Supplies: we agreed to retire the Brightline fixture range by year-end. Remaining stock moves to clearance pricing next month, and accounts on standing orders get migrated to the Lumetta range. Trade-in incentives were approved in principle. The confidential note on next steps sits just below.

board note of bajof-bajeg: The pricing group signed off on a budget of $13.4 million for Project Sildor. The renewal with Lamixek Holdings closes at $48.9 million a year, 49 percent above the last contract.